IGF 1 LR3 is a modified IGF molecule evaluated for its prolonged activity in pathways related to cellular growth and metabolic function. Researchers examine how it interacts with receptors driving protein synthesis, nutrient signaling, and growth regulation. Scientific models explore its extended signaling profile and influence on metabolic behavior. Its long acting nature makes it useful for controlled studies on growth pathways and cellular performance.
